How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Cedar Grove?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Cedar Grove Studio Apartments | $2,382 | $1,450 | $8,881 |
Cedar Grove 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,750 | $998 | $9,813 |
Cedar Grove 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,451 | $717 | $10,000+ |
Cedar Grove 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,040 | $808 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Cedar Grove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Cedar Grove with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Cedar Grove is at Garrett Village listed at $1,985.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Cedar Grove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Cedar Grove is $3,451.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Cedar Grove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Cedar Grove is a 1,500 square feet unit starting from $2,795 at Chanler at Montclair.
What is the average size for Cedar Grove 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Cedar Grove is currently 1,274 sq ft.
